自托管网络电台系统
各维度得分依据公开资料与字段推算,加权后即综合评分,仅供参考。
AzuraCast 是一套自托管的一体化 Web 电台管理软件,目标是让用户在 VPS、独立服务器或 Linux 计算机上快速搭建网络电台。它通过 Docker 安装,集成 Liquidsoap、Icecast-KH、NGINX、MariaDB、Redis、Centrifugo 等组件,安装后可通过浏览器管理电台。官方明确提示项目仍处于 beta,建议持续更新并做好媒体与数据库备份。
面向电台运营,AzuraCast 覆盖媒体上传、元数据编辑、文件夹整理、播放列表、定时播放、Live DJ、浏览器 Web DJ、听众点歌、公共播放器页面和远程中继等场景。面向管理员,它支持多电台集中管理、角色与细粒度权限、用户账号、备份恢复、日志查看、自动 nginx 代理、Cloudflare 兼容代理,以及本地或 S3 兼容存储。它还提供认证 REST API,用户可创建 API key,且官方说明前端操作均通过 API 完成,因此开发者可以基于 API 构建自定义播放器、管理界面或自动化流程。
AzuraCast 可免费安装和使用,包括商业用途,并以捐赠支持项目维护。实际成本主要来自 VPS、服务器、带宽和对象存储。部署方面,官方推荐 Docker,安装脚本可处理 Docker 与 Docker Compose;也提供 Linode、Vultr、DigitalOcean 一键镜像。自建安装需要 root 或 sudo 权限,以及基本 Linux shell 能力。
优点是功能完整、开源透明、API 能力强,且文档覆盖安装、管理、故障排查和开发者接口,适合长期自控的电台系统。缺点是 beta 状态下升级仍有风险;多挂载点、转码、HLS 或高 CPU 功能可能要求更强服务器;Docker、端口、数据库迁移等问题需要一定运维经验。Shoutcast 2 DNAS 也不是随包捆绑的自由软件。
它适合独立电台、社区/校园广播、播客式 24 小时音乐流、以及需要自定义前端和 API 自动化的团队。不太适合完全不想接触服务器维护的用户。抓取文本未提供中国大陆网络与支付可用性信息,访问状态记为未知;若部署在境内或面向境内听众,还需自行评估服务器、域名、备案、音乐版权和带宽。替代方向可考虑 Icecast、Shoutcast、LibreTime 等。
本测评基于公开资料整理,不构成购买建议,请以 azuracast.com 官网实际信息为准。
免费开源,适合自建电台/音频流媒体。
评分明细(分布与用户短评)接入中。当前展示 TG4G 综合评分,数据源自公开测评与用户反馈。